我正在向 Kafka 写入一条消息并在另一端使用它。 在其中进行一些处理并将其写回另一个 Kafka 主题。
我想知道哪个消息响应针对哪个请求..
目前决定从消费者端捕获偏移 ID,然后写入响应并读取响应负载并做出相同的决定。
对于这种方法,我们需要读取每条消息,是否有其他方法可以根据消费者配置条件进行消费?
最佳答案
消费者只能阅读整个主题。您只能通过 seek()
跳过消息,但没有可以在代理上评估的条件来过滤消息。
您将需要在客户端中使用整个主题的进程/过滤器。
关于apache-kafka - 我可以根据Kafka中的特定条件进行消费吗?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/39634354/